theflyingsweede Posted January 23, 2019 Share #1 Posted January 23, 2019 Here is a 101st Airborne grouping that I picked up a few years ago from a Pappas family member. Cris Pappas was not in on the D Day invasion but joined up with the 101st before the Holland drop, Market Garden, and was with them till the end. The P38 he captured on the Market Garden drop, for me this is the best part of this grouping since I collect P38's. It also has the capture paperwork.
